The chiral critical point from the strong coupling expansion
High Energy Physics - Lattice
2025-02-11 v1
Abstract
The strong coupling expansion for staggered fermions allows for Monte Carlo simulations using a dual representation. It has a mild sign problem for low values of the inverse gauge coupling , hence the phase diagram in the full plane can be evaluated. We have extended this framework to include and corrections, by mapping the degrees of freedom to a vertex model. We present results on the -dependence of the chiral critical point from those simulations.
